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
728178 952 98064864 0524 38577691
1155873 2059754 105941612
1155873 2059754 105941612
22210 774984 410677646 47 68
All about undefined
Interested in learning more?
1155873 2059754 105941612
22210 774984 410677646 47 68
See more
063 58417662
40 83 9459042 09313600
See more
8068 61116449613
27 55920 60010188373
See more